English: BARBATE, Spain (April 19, 2011) Gunnery Sgt. Jason Neale, right, military advisor for Naval Mobile Construction Battalion (NMCB) 74, and Construction Mechanic 3rd Class Zach Cirocco demonstrate how to change the barrel of an M-240B machine gun during crew-served weapons training at the Sierra del Retin weapons range. (U.S. Navy photo by Mass Communication Specialist 1st Class Ryan G. Wilber/Released) |
